1931 windshield still loose
Hi all - I have a 1931 roadster and despite tightening the nuts on the sides of the windshield, it keeps falling forward if we're not hanging on to it. The glass itself is fine - it's the entire assembly. I can't really drive with the top down because I'm afraid of the windshield falling over and breaking. Any ideas? The wing nuts are as tight as I can and as tight as I dare. Thanks in advance!

Re: 1931 windshield still loose
The cups in the upper stanchions, -or the bosses on the lower stanchions are excessively worn. Not necessarily an easy repair since the repro cups are not that good either, but if you work at it, you should be able to make the tapered areas have a better interference fit.
